HTML content can be minified and compressed by a website’s server. The most efficient way is to compress content using GZIP which reduces data amount travelling through the network between server and browser. This page needs HTML code to be minified as it can gain 17.8 kB, which is 20% of the original size. It is highly recommended that content of this web page should be compressed using GZIP, as it can save up to 73.3 kB or 84% of the original size.

Language claimed in HTML meta tag should match the language actually used on the web page. Otherwise Decollouomo.com can be misinterpreted by Google and other search engines. Our service has detected that Japanese is used on the page, and neither this language nor any other was claimed in <html> or <meta> tags. Our system also found out that Decollouomo.com main page’s claimed encoding is utf-8. Use of this encoding format is the best practice as the main page visitors from all over the world won’t have any issues with symbol transcription.
